Bethea Leads Women's Basketball in Season Opener at Seton Hall

SOUTH ORANGE, NJ – The Saint Peter's women's basketball team opened the season with a 91-49 defeat on the road at New Jersey rival, Seton Hall of the Big East. Senior Sajanna Bethea (Levittown, PA/Pennsbury) led the Peacocks in the opener with team-highs in scoring (eight points) and rebounding (nine rebounds).

 

The Peacocks came out with stellar defense to open the contest and in the first quarter. Saint Peter's opened the contest with a 4-3 lead behind put back layups from Bethea and Talah Hughes (Beacon, NY/Beacon). By the game's first break, the Peacocks were holding Seton Hall to 8.3 percent shooting in the game, but trailed 5-4. A midrange baseline jumper and a long two-pointer by Zoe Pero (Secaucus, NJ/St. John Vianney), extended the Peacock lead to 8-5. Seton Hall then went on a late 11-0 run, taking a 16-8 advantage, but a layup by Sammy Lochner (Abington, PA/Abington) cut the score to 16-10 to end the first quarter. Saint Peter's held Seton hall to 25 percent shooting (5-20) in the first quarter.

 

In the second quarter, the Peacocks fell behind 20-10 before Alyssa Velles (Franklin, CT/Norwich Free Academy) knocked down a trifecta on a feed from Samantha Meier (Manalapan, NJ/Manalapan), bringing the game back to single-digits at 20-13. Seton Hall went back up by double figures, then Hughes notched a layup and a Bethea layup from  freshman D'Aviyon Magazine (Paterson, NJ/Queen of Peace) on a give and go, cut the deficit under 10 again, at 28-20. Seton Hall added another 11-0 run, off of seven Peacock turnovers making the Pirates lead grow to 19. Right before the half, Bethea scored to end the Peacock drought and Lochner added a three, to bring the score to 40-25 at intermission. The Peacocks continued to play good defense in the second quarter, holding Seton Hall to just 33.3 percent shooting from the field and 25 percent from long range in the half. The difference in the half was Saint Peter's gave up 20 turnovers, which led to 22 points for Seton Hall.

 

Out of the break, the Peacocks stayed within the same deficit range of the Pirates, seeing scores by Bethea, Brianna Tarabocchia (Woodcliff Lake, NJ/Northern Valley Demarest), and Dajiah Martin (Westbury, NY/Saint Mary's) as the Peacocks trailed 49-32. Then, Seton Hall went on a third run of the day, this time putting together a 15-0 run, that extended the lead over Saint Peter's to 64-32. Before the quarter ended, Magazine hit four free throws and Hughes added a layup on a cut to the basket to send the game into the final quarter at 69-38.

 

In the final quarter, Precious Featherson (Paterson, NJ/Rosa Parks) scored the Peacock's first three points, then Breana Spencer (Plainfield, NJ/Plainfield) made a layup off of a dime from Haley Dalonzo (Lincroft, NJ/Middletown High School South), making the game, an 85-43 deficit with 3:50 left. Ashlie Howell (Bronx, NY/Christ The King) anchored the next two Peacock baskets, feeding Anna Maguire for a layup and then hitting Dalonzo for layup. Maguire hit a runner, for the final basket of game to close out the afternoon with a 91-49 setback.  

 

Following Bethea on the scoreboard for Saint Peter's were Magazine with seven points, Hughes with six points, and Lochner with five points.
